A new program of visual double-star observations obtained during the
period from May 26, 1982 to Feb. 24, 1983 at the Torino Astronomical
Observatory is discussed. A list concerning 480 micrometric measurements
of 149 pairs is reported. For orbital double stars, a comparison with
the orbits reported by Muller and Couteau (1979) is given.
